Cost to Own a Parking Lot: Estimated Price and Budget Guide 2026

Owners typically consider construction cost, ongoing maintenance cost, and operating price when budgeting for a parking lot. This guide provides practical price ranges in USD, with assumptions, to help plan capital outlays and long-term expenses.

Assumptions: region, lot size, traffic level, and required drainage and lighting specs vary; ranges reflect common commercial projects in the U.S.

Overview Of Costs

Pricing spans a broad spectrum depending on lot size, surfacing type, drainage needs, and local permit costs. For a typical mid-size commercial lot (about 100–200 spaces) with asphalt, lighting, and basic security, total project costs commonly range from $800,000 to $2,500,000. Per-space estimates often fall in the $8,000–$25,000 range when land is included, and may be lower if the land is already owned. Per-square-foot estimates for paving generally run $3.50–$6.50, with higher costs for heavy-use zones or steeper grades.

Ongoing ownership costs include annual maintenance, insurance, taxes, and a reserve for major repairs. Yearly maintenance budgets commonly run 1–4% of the initial project cost, depending on climate, traffic, and surface condition. If a property already has drainage and lighting, the upfront cost decreases but replacement and updates may still be needed over time.

What Drives Price

Project scale, site accessibility, and material choices drive the majority of costs. Key variables include lot size (spaces or acres), surface type (asphalt vs concrete), drainage complexity (swales, basins), and required ADA compliance. For example, a 10,000-square-foot lot with standard paving, 50 ADA stalls, and basic lighting will cost less than a 3-acre site with reinforced concrete, advanced cameras, and coordinated stormwater systems. If land acquisition is needed, the price scales substantially higher.

Cost Drivers

Regional differences influence pricing due to labor markets, permitting costs, and material availability. A site in a metropolitan area may see higher bids than a suburban or rural project. Materials pricing can also swing with fuel costs and supplier demand. Expect notable variance by region and season.

Ways To Save

Strategies to reduce upfront and ongoing costs include choosing asphalt over concrete where appropriate, phasing the project, and leveraging existing utilities and drainage. If upfront capital is tight, consider a staged approach: complete critical entrances and spaces first, then expand as needed. Maintenance planning, including periodic sealcoat and line repainting, preserves surface life and lowers long-term repair costs. Insurance and tax assessments can be optimized through accurate asset valuation and bundled policies.

Regional Price Differences

Pricing varies across regions. In the Northeast, urban land costs and permitting can push total outlays upward. The Midwest often benefits from lower land and labor costs, while the West Coast may face higher material and wage rates. Typical regional deltas range from -10% to +25% relative to a national baseline, influenced by project size and local regulations.

Labor & Installation Time

Labor intensity affects total costs. A medium-sized lot may require 4–8 weeks of site work, with 2–3 weeks of paving and striping in moderate climates. Labor rates differ; urban crews usually command higher hourly rates than rural crews. A longer build timeline can incur temporary site management and erosion control expenses.

Additional & Hidden Costs

Surprises include stormwater compliance, ADA renovations, and future-proofing for EV charging or security upgrades. Financing costs, inflation buffers, and permit approval delays can add 5–15% to the budget. Factor in contingency reserves to cover unforeseen site or regulatory changes.
